The Brandeis University volleyball team beat the Rivier University Raiders in four sets Tuesday night, 25-15, 25-14, 22-25, 25-16. With the win the Judges improve to 13-11, guaranteeing at least a .500 record heading into the UAA Tournament. Rivier falls to 17-10 with the loss.
FOR THE JUDGES
-
Freshman Marissa Borgert (Blaine, Minn. / Spring Lake Park) contributed in all five of the major categories, with eight kills, a team-high 19 assists, five digs, three service aces, and three block assists.
-
Three other Judges had eight or more kills. Junior Shea Decker-Jacoby (Los Angeles, Calif. / Marymount) led with ten, freshman Clare Meyers (Richfield, Wisc. / Slinger) had nine, and junior Kirsten Frauens (Webster, N.Y. / Webster Schroeder) had eight apiece. Decker-Jacoby hit an efficient .360, with only one attack error in the match on 25 attempts.
-
Junior Marlee Nork (Chicago, IL / Walter Payton College Prep) was the other main setter for the Judges, amassing 18 assists.
-
Junior Yvette Cho (San Diego, Calif. / Rancho Bernardo) had a match-high 17 digs. Decker-Jacoby also had eight digs.
-
Aside from Borgert, three other Brandeis players tied for a team-high three service aces: Decker-Jacoby, Cho, and Nork.
-
Sophomore Emma Bartlett (Duxbury, Mass. / Duxbury) had a team-high four blocks (one solo, three assists).
-
The Judges hit .224 for the match (42K-16E-116TA)
